In sintesi

Triggering a large slab avalanche is most likely on steep slopes facing the northern two-thirds of the compass, especially in the eastern part of this zone where the snowpack is thinner. Anticipate loose snow avalanches in very steep, rocky terrain receiving direct sun.

    Slabs that formed in early February rest above a variety of ugly, widespread, weak layers (facets, surface hoar, crusts, and combinations). Tuesday, a large persistent slab avalanche was triggered on a NW facing slope on Patterson Pk above Hailey.

    Observers and professionals around the Wood River Valley continue to report frequent collapsing or whumpfing. These are clear signs that triggering one of these slides remains a real possibility. Persistent Slabs can release in surprising ways and break much wider than expected. You are most likely to trigger a dense, 2-4 foot thick avalanche where:

    • The slab is less than about 2' thick—this is the case on many slopes surrounding the Wood River Valley. Relatively shallower spots may exist where the wind frequently blows.
    • Any part of the slope you are on or connected to is steeper than about 35 degrees
    • The slope faces the northern 2/3 of the compass
    • A smaller wind slab or loose snow avalanche overloads the buried weak layers

    (2/18/2025) A skier on Patterson Pk near Hailey triggered this large avalanche. After several turns on the slope, the slide broke above and around them. Thankfully, the skier was able to ski ahead and to the side of the slab. NW @ 8,050'.

    Recent snowfall has increased the odds of loose snow avalanches on all aspects. The largest of these are most likely on very steep, rocky slopes receiving direct sun. These slides often initiate near the base of trees and rocks, gathering snow and growing in size as they move downhill. Rollerballs, or pinwheels, signify that the snow is heating up, and wet avalanches may soon follow. 

    While most will start small, they could be large enough to knock you off your feet and carry you into unwanted terrain. Even small slides are consequential above terrain traps such as gullies, creeks, and thick timber. Plan your day to avoid lingering under steep, sunny slopes when the sun is out.

Avalanche Discussion

Given the recent snowfall and wind, continue to look for and avoid steep slopes with obvious recent wind loading or signs of instability, like snowpack cracking or collapsing. Sluffing in very steep terrain is possible in dry snow on shaded slopes but is much more likely on any very steep slope soaking in the sun. Be aware of where even small avalanches may take you; terrain traps increase the consequence of being caught or buried.

Tuesday, a skier on Patterson Pk near Hailey triggered a large persistent slab avalanche. The slide broke above and around them after several turns on the slope. Thankfully, the skier was able to ski ahead and to the side of the slab. We've observed multiple avalanches in thin snowpacks around the Wood River Valley since the first week of February:

  • February 6th: Natural avalanches on Patterson Pk (info)
  • February 9th: Skier triggered slide in Lake Creek (info, video)
  • February 16th-17th: Avalanches on Sun Mountain (info 1, info 2)
  • February 18th: Skier triggered slide on Patterson Pk (info)

These slides occurred on shadier NW-NE-E aspects where the slab was around 2' thick. Persistent slab problems can take a long time to heal. These slides and reports of collapsing in shallow snowpacks clearly indicate that triggering one of these slides remains a concern. Remember that tracks on a slope do not mean it's safe. Avalanches could be triggered after multiple people have skied the slope.
